The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KP) government has introduced the Ehsaas Apna Ghar Scheme, a groundbreaking initiative designed to help low-income families build or improve their homes. The scheme offers interest-free loans of up to Rs 1.5 million for eligible families, aiming to uplift the living conditions of disadvantaged communities across the province.
Feature | Details |
Loan Amount | Up to Rs 1.5 million |
Repayment Period | 7 years |
Monthly Installments | Maximum Rs 18,000 |
Total Allocation | Rs 4 billion |

Interest-Free Loans for Affordable Housing
Under this scheme, families with limited financial means can apply for loans to construct new homes or renovate existing properties. With a revolving fund system, the project will continue for seven years, ensuring long-term support. The maximum monthly repayment of Rs 18,000 has been designed to keep the loans affordable for beneficiaries. The KP government has allocated Rs 4 billion for the project, showcasing its commitment to addressing the housing crisis faced by low-income families. This initiative is a significant step toward reducing financial burdens for those striving to improve their living standards.
Eligibility Criteria and Application Requirements
To apply for the Ehsaas Apna Ghar Scheme, appl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ria, including:
- Land Ownership: Applicants must own a piece of land for the construction or renovation of a home.
- Income Status: Priority will be given to families with lower income levels.
- Housing Needs: Applicants must demonstrate a genuine need for financial assistance to build or improve their homes.
This program ensures that deserving families receive the financial support they need while maintaining transparency and fairness in the selection process.
Commitment to Low-Income Housing
Chief Minister Ali Amin Gandapur underlined the government’s commitment to enhancing housing conditions for low-income households during the inaugural event. “Access to high-quality housing is one of our top priorities,” he said. He remarked, “Providing access to quality housing is one of our top priorities. The Ehsaas Apna Ghar Scheme reflects our resolve to enhance living standards for underprivileged communities.” This program builds on the KP government’s previous efforts, such as the low-cost housing scheme launched in October. That initiative targeted families earning less than Rs 50,000 per month and planned the construction of 1,320 affordable apartments.
